Essential Tools for Tire Inspection
To effectively inspect tires, several tools are necessary to ensure a thorough evaluation. A tire pressure gauge is vital for measuring the air pressure in each tire, helping to maintain optimal performance and safety. A tread depth gauge is another indispensable tool, allowing you to assess the remaining tread on your tires, which is crucial for maintaining traction.
An inspection mirror can aid in checking hard-to-see areas for any signs of damage or foreign objects lodged in the tread. A flashlight is also beneficial for illuminating these areas during your inspection, especially in lower light conditions.
Additionally, a tire repair kit can be useful for addressing minor issues on the spot, such as punctures. Lastly, a torque wrench is recommended for checking the lug nut tension if you’re considering rotating your tires or changing them altogether. Having these essential tools on hand facilitates a comprehensive inspection, aligning with the best practices for vehicle maintenance.
Understanding Tire Components
Tires are composed of several key components that contribute to their overall performance, safety, and longevity. The primary parts of a tire include the tread, sidewall, beads, and inner liner. Understanding these components is essential for effective vehicle maintenance, particularly when learning how to inspect tires.
The tread is the outer layer that makes contact with the road surface. It features a unique pattern designed for traction, grip, and water displacement. Inspecting the tread for wear is critical, as insufficient tread depth can compromise vehicle handling and increase stopping distances.
The sidewall is the section that connects the tread to the beads, which hold the tire in place on the wheel rim. It plays a role in maintaining air pressure and providing structural support. Damage to the sidewall, such as cuts or bulges, can indicate a need for further inspection or immediate replacement.
The inner liner prevents air loss and contributes to overall tire integrity. A thorough understanding of these tire components ensures proper maintenance and aids in recognizing issues early, enhancing safety and performance.

How to Check Tire Pressure
To verify tire pressure, the first step is to use a reliable tire pressure gauge, which can be digital or analog. Ensure the tires are cold, as pressure increases with temperature. Locate the valve stem on each tire and remove the cap to access the valve.
Next, firmly press the tire pressure gauge onto the valve stem. The gauge will provide a reading of the tire’s air pressure. Compare this reading with the manufacturer’s recommended pressure, usually found on a sticker inside the driver’s door or in the vehicle’s manual.
If the tire pressure is low, add air until it reaches the recommended level. Conversely, if the pressure exceeds the recommended amount, release some air until it aligns properly. Repeat the process for all tires to ensure balanced pressure, vital for optimal vehicle performance and safety.
Evaluating Tread Depth
Tread depth refers to the measurement of the grooves in a tire’s surface, which affects traction and overall performance. Inspecting tread depth is fundamental in understanding how to inspect tires, as insufficient tread can lead to decreased safety on the road, especially in adverse weather conditions.
To evaluate tread depth, you may use a tread depth gauge for precise measurements. Alternatively, the penny test allows for a quick assessment; inserting a penny into the tread with Lincoln’s head facing down provides a visual reference. If the top of Lincoln’s head is visible, the tread depth is inadequate.
The minimum legal tread depth in many regions is 2/32 of an inch. However, for optimal performance, maintaining at least 4/32 of an inch is recommended, particularly for wet driving conditions. Regularly checking tread depth not only enhances safety but also extends the lifespan of your tires by ensuring even wear.

Inspecting for Damage and Wear
Inspecting tires for damage and wear involves a careful examination of various conditions that can affect performance and safety. Common indicators of damage include cracks, cuts, and blisters on the tire surface, which can compromise structural integrity. Inspecting these areas while ensuring adequate lighting can help reveal any hidden issues.
Additionally, check for unusual bulges along the sidewalls. These bulges may suggest a weak spot that could lead to a blowout if not addressed promptly. Regular visual inspections can help detect these potentially hazardous conditions before they escalate.
Moreover, look for uneven wear patterns on the tread. Such patterns may indicate alignment or suspension issues, necessitating further evaluation. Recognizing these signs early can significantly enhance vehicle safety and performance.

Symptoms of Misalignment
When tires are misaligned, several noticeable symptoms may arise, indicating the need for closer inspection. One common sign is uneven tire wear, often observed as bald patches on one side of the tire, making it apparent that alignment issues are present.
Additionally, drivers may experience a vehicle that pulls to one side while driving. This pulling sensation can often be detected during straight-line driving and may lead to erratic handling, which can compromise safety.
Another indicator of misalignment is a steering wheel that is off-center while the vehicle is driving straight. This misalignment can cause unnecessary strain on various steering and suspension components, leading to further mechanical problems over time.
Finally, audible noises, such as squeaking or grinding from the tires, may also suggest misalignment. Regularly inspecting tires not only helps in identifying such symptoms but ensures optimal performance and safety for the vehicle.

How to Verify Alignment
To verify alignment, begin by examining the vehicle’s steering and handling characteristics during a test drive. Pay attention to any pulling sensations to one side, as this can indicate alignment issues.
Next, check tire wear patterns. Uneven wear across the tread often signifies misalignment, while even wear suggests proper alignment. Consider the following points when assessing tire wear:
- Inner or outer edge wear
- Center tread wear
- Cup-shaped or scalloped wear patterns
Finally, use alignment measurement tools, such as a camber gauge or an alignment rack, to obtain precise readings. These devices determine the angles of the wheels in relation to the vehicle’s body. Align the measurements with the manufacturer’s specifications to ensure optimal performance and safety.
Seasonal Tire Maintenance Tips
Seasonal tire maintenance is integral to ensuring optimal tire performance and longevity. As temperatures change, tires can be affected differently, making it essential to inspect and adjust them accordingly. For instance, during colder months, tire pressure tends to drop, necessitating regular inflation checks.
When transitioning to winter tires, proper installation and alignment are paramount. Winter tires offer enhanced traction but require careful inspection for wear or damage before use. In contrast, summer tires should be checked for tread depth to ensure adequate grip during warmer months.
It is advisable to store off-season tires in a cool, dry area, away from direct sunlight. Proper tire storage includes maintaining a consistent pressure and ensuring they are mounted securely on a tire rack or in a position that prevents deformation. Regular tire rotation and balancing may also be beneficial during seasonal changes to prevent uneven wear.

Signs It’s Time for Replacement
Examine your tires closely for indicators that replacement is necessary. One primary sign is visible tread wear. If the tread depth is below 2/32 of an inch, it is time to consider replacement to ensure optimal traction and safety on the road.
Another significant indicator is the presence of cracks, bulges, or blisters on the tire’s surface. These defects compromise the tire’s integrity and can lead to blowouts. Regularly inspecting for such damage is vital to maintaining vehicle safety.
Additionally, uneven wear patterns can signal alignment issues that may necessitate new tires. Tires that wear excessively on one side indicate misalignment, which may reduce their lifespan significantly.
Lastly, if a tire frequently loses air pressure despite no apparent puncture, it may be reaching the end of its useful life. Recognizing these signs will help drivers make informed decisions regarding when to replace tires, ultimately enhancing safety and performance.
Understanding Tire Lifespan
Tire lifespan is defined as the duration a tire can effectively perform its intended function before it must be replaced. This lifespan is influenced by various factors, including tire composition, usage conditions, and maintenance practices. Generally, tires may last between 40,000 to 80,000 miles, but a thorough inspection can help to determine their actual condition.
Several indicators can help assess the remaining lifespan of tires. These include tread depth, visible wear patterns, and any damage such as sidewall bulges or cuts. Regular checks can reveal underlying issues that might affect performance and safety.
The age of the tire is another critical factor in its lifespan. Most manufacturers recommend replacing tires every six years, regardless of tread wear. It is advisable to check the manufacturing date, usually found on the tire sidewall, to ensure timely replacements.
Proper care and maintenance practices can significantly extend tire lifespan. Some maintenance activities include maintaining optimal tire pressure, rotating tires regularly, and ensuring proper alignment. These practices not only enhance tire longevity but also improve overall vehicle performance.
